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y
Jobs / Job page
Senior Software Engineer (Hybrid Role) image - Rise Careers
Job details

Senior Software Engineer (Hybrid Role)

About Rimes

Rimes provides enterprise data management solutions to the global investment community. Driven by our passion for solving the most complex data problems, we provide our clients with investment intelligence that powers more than US$75 trillion in assets under management annually. The world’s leading institutional investors, asset managers and service providers rely on Rimes to help them make better investment decisions using accurate information and industry-leading technology.

A Software Engineer - Python with proven experience from a software vendor or SaaS vendor with data heavy products. Able to work towards a common goal as part of a cross functional distributed team and work once given direction. Should have positive attitude towards solving challenges and finding new ways. The person will be motivated by continuous improvement in terms of driving and delivering quality with efficiency. 

Key Responsibilities:

  • Design, implement and integrate new functionalities to data centric applications built as microservices and data pipelines.
  • Build scalable and robust application in a distributed multi-tenant Hybrid cloud architecture
  • Participate to the full life cycle of the user stories taking requirements from product management and working with QA engineer and end user to qualify your work
  • Bring ideas and solutions to complex technical problems during team workshop
  • Review your team mates code in peer review within Git
  • Be part of a cross functional team and therefore pair with Devops or QA resource to solve CI/CD or test automations requiring complex developments - or simply help them
  • Contribute to cross team innovation being part of one of our community of practices
  • Learn new skills and share your knowledge to other during transversal knowledge transfer sessions

Key Principles & Ways of working:

  • An agile DevOps approach to daily workload.
  • Used to sharing and management of knowledge.
  • Continuous improvement operating model in an agile environment.
  • Challenge and innovate existing processes, tools, culture, and technology.
  • Capable to follow high level directions to implement continuous improvement.
  • Ensure work is delivered consistently to design and build principles and standards.
  • A continual learning culture and initiative to stay present with latest technological trends.
  • Problem-solving and analytical skills and the ability to come up with creative solutions.

Relevant Experience and skills:

  • 5+ years of experience 
  • Bachelor's degree in computer science, computer engineering or relevant field.
  • Relevant experience in programming data centric applications and pipelines.
  • Able to articulate practical examples of complex problem solved.
  • Strong experience in Python coding and experience with others
  • JavaScript React development is a plus
  • Knowledge of pandas library and/or Apache Spark.
  • SQL Server coding experience.
  • Exposure to microservices architecture, deployment challenges etc.
  • Experience with working with Python packaged containers.
  • Knowledge, understanding of and(or) experience of:
    • OWAPS 10 prevention.
    • Version control systems e.g. Git/GitHub.
    • Unit testing as an habit.
    • Deployment automation (on-premises & cloud).
    • Awareness or use of principles like: Code reuse, DRY, KISS, YAGNI.
    • JIRA, Confluence, Kanban boards etc.
    • Automated testing and integration as part of CI/CD pipelines.
    • Code linting and static code analysis.
    • Containerisation (Docker & Docker Compose) & Orchestration (Kubernetes) concepts
  • Experience in developing Cloud application (using relevant Cloud Services ideally Azure)
  • A genuine passion for new ideas and technology excellence as well as passion for automation of Infrastructure. Repeatable patterns, pipelines, and security integrations.

Team Technical stack

  • Atlassian Jira
  • Atlassian Confluence
  • Hybrid cloud architecture: Azure Cloud & On Premise
  • CI/CD: Jenkins & Azure DevOps
  • Microservice
  • Message Bus / RabbitMQ
  • Azure Kubernetes / Docker
  • MS SQL
  • Git hub
  • Azure Search / ELK / Redis
  • Python / C# / Perl / C / JavaScript React

What We Offer: 

  • Private Medical Insurance
  • Private Provident Fund
  • 26 days of annual leave
  • 5 days paid sick leave
  • Breakfast and snacks
  • Smoothie Fridays

Compensation: Competitive pay and bonus eligibility

Work Life Balance: Flexible hybrid work environment (#LI-Hybrid)

Our Values:

  • Client excellence
  • Innovation
  • Integrity
  • Empowerment

 

Rimes is committed to promote the values of diversity and inclusion throughout the business. Whether it’s through recruitment, retention, career progression or training and development, we are committed to improving opportunities for people regardless of their background or circumstances.

Visit our Careers page to see our complete listings.

Rimes Technologies Glassdoor Company Review
4.4 Glassdoor star iconGlassdoor star iconGlassdoor star iconGlassdoor star icon Glassdoor star icon
Rimes Technologies DE&I Review
No rating Glassdoor star iconGlassdoor star iconGlassdoor star iconGlassdoor star iconGlassdoor star icon
CEO of Rimes Technologies
Rimes Technologies CEO photo
Brad Hunt
Approve of CEO

Average salary estimate

$0 / YEARLY (est.)
min
max
$0K
$0K

If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

Similar Jobs
Photo of the Rise User
NISC Remote Lake Saint Louis, MO
Posted 3 days ago
Photo of the Rise User
2K Remote Prague, Czech Republic
Posted 5 days ago
Photo of the Rise User
BCC Software Remote 1890 S Winton Rd, Rochester, NY 14618, USA
Posted 10 days ago

RIMES was founded in 1996 in New York City specifically to meet the specialist data needs of the buy-side. We were a pioneer provider of managed data services, using cloud-based technology to deliver highly customized financial data over the inter...

18 jobs
MATCH
VIEW MATCH
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
EMPLOYMENT TYPE
Full-time, hybrid
DATE POSTED
December 1, 2024

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!